Japan Society for the Promotion of Science, Grants-in-Aid for Scientific Research, Research on Genetic Diversity of Sika Deer living in Osaka, 2003, 2005, KAWAI Yuji; OHTANI Shintarou; ISHIZUKA Yuzuru; HOSHI Hideyuki, It is thought that sika deer in Osaka Prefecture were divided into three populations in 1970's, and were isolated from the surrounding. There have been three populations (Nose, Minoo and Takatsuki). Recently, three populations were presumed to have expanded the distribution region. DNA samples from three populations were amplified by PCR and primers of microsatellites were seleced according to genetic polymorphism seen in the appearance of the bands of electrophoresis. Five primers were selected: BM2934,BoviRBP, MB009,OarFCB193,TGLA53. The appearance of each band was assumed as autonomous variable, and the cluster analysis by the Ward method was executed. Moreover, the genetic relatedness between individuals was calculated by software Kinship. As a result of the cluster analysis, the populations divided into two groups, Nose group, and Minoo and Takatsuki group. The genetic relatedness of Nose, Minoo and Takatsuki was 0.45(mean), 0.42 and 0.51 respectively. The array of the D-loop area of mitochondria DNA was decided by using as Nose, Minoo, Takatsuki, Hyogo, Kyoto, Wakayama and White-tailed deer. The phylogenetic tree was made with computer software Clustal W by using arrays of D-loop except the tandem-repeat region. The individuals of Minoo and Takatsuki formed the cluster respectively. In addition, the phylogenetic tree was made by data of Accession Number AB012364-AB012385 of the DDBJ/EMBL/GeneBank nucleotide array data base. In the cluster analysis, all the individuasl of Osaka were classified as northem Japan group. A genetic diversity was caliculated by D-loop dmain's Haplotype. A genetic diversity was 0.64 in Nose, 0.67 in Minoo, and 0.50 in Takatsuki, respectively.
